Makinde’s Endorsement Not A Decision Of All Of Us – Ibadan Mogajis React

...Say "We Cannot Endorse Any Candidate, We Can Only Bless"

Sequel to last week endorsement of Governor Seyi Makinde for second term by some Ibadan Family Heads known as Mogajis, Over 27 Mogajis in Ibadan have dissociated themselves from the endorsement, stating that they do not have any favourite candidate for the 2023 gubernatorial election.

Meanwhile, they emphasized that they are not against the candidacy of Governor Seyi Makinde, adding that he will be well received, whenever he comes for blessings.

The Ibadan Mogajis disclosed this during a press conference on Tuesday, Ibadan, the Oyo state capital.

The Mogajis revealed that those who claimed to have endorsed the Governor are politicians who called themselves Mogajis, stressing that all candidates who met with them only came for blessings.

They added that the Mogajis will never announce a favorite candidate for 2023 gubernatorial election in the state.

While speaking on behalf of the Mogajis after their meeting, Mogaji Muktar Adewale Gbadeyanka stated that the lay claim endorsement was not the decision of all Mogajis in Ibadanland, but rather by those who are representing their own interest.

According to him, Governor Seyi Makinde and other governorship candidates are friends with the Mogajis.

He said: “What prompted this gathering is because we Ibadan Mogajis have not anointed any candidate. The reason is because we Ibadan Mogajis are not politicians. All candidates have been coming to us to seek blessing from us, including those candidates who are not Indegene of Ibadanland.

“The purported endorsement holds no water because all towns have its rules and regulations. Ibadanland has culture and rules, Olubadan and the Olubadan-in-Council don’t endorse but only bless candidates which affect them positively, that is why we, the Mogajis cannot also endorse any candidate.

Gbadeyanka, explaining further on what transpired said: “Over 200 Ibadan Mogajis converged for a meeting last week Friday at Ibadan Northest Local Government. One of us, who is a senatorial candidate came to us during our meeting and seek our blessing.

“He didn’t request for our support. He only sought our blessing, but we were surprised to see a media report that some Mogajis have endorsed a candidate.

“He told us that the Governor has also been planning to meet us, particularly the Olubadan of Ibadanland to recieve his blessing. The Governor is expecting our blessing, and we are also expecting his coming.

“There is no misunderstanding among the Ibadan Mogajis. We are all one. We are even yet to know if those that endorsed the candidate are Mogajis.”
